The Details About 455 West 20th Street

Located within the grounds of the General Theological Seminary, 455 West 20th Street is a condominium comprised of two buildings: the conversion of one of the oldest buildings in Chelsea and the latest addition to this historic neighborhood. The two buildings are connected by a glass atrium-style lobby. The residences feature interiors by celebrated architect Alan Wanzenberg, whose commitment ...

Get to know Chelsea

As one of New York City’s most well-known sections, it’s a bit jarring to learn how expansive an area Chelsea is. You may solely think of the cozy restaurants or the art galleries or the High Line, but from 14th Street to 34th and Sixth Avenue to the Hudson, Chelsea is all those things and more. Seems like way too much to travel? Worry not: Because of its breadth, Chelsea is beyond well-serviced by the subway and can be experienced along the F and M lines on Sixth, the 1, 2, and 3 on Seventh, and the A, C, and E on Eighth. Even the 7 train is nearby, just beyond the border with Hudson Yards. Perhaps this is partly why the neighborhood has become synonymous with the city experience: If you’re going to Manhattan, you’re certainly going to spend time in Chelsea.
